“Treasure Quest, Part I of VI”

DC's "Year One" initiative gets a compelling entry with this 2007 miniseries opener, retelling the early days of Rex Mason — the patchwork elemental hero better known as Metamorpho. Kevin Nowlan's cover sets the tone beautifully, placing the multicolored, bald-headed Metamorpho in dynamic mid-stride at center, a hammer-like fist raised, while a glamorous blonde woman dominates the foreground and a looming shadowed face watches from the background — with a fourth figure, a stocky man in the shadows, rounding out the intrigue. With Dan Jurgens writing and drawing and Jesse Delperdang on inks, "Treasure Quest, Part I of VI" promises a fresh, grounded look at one of DC's most visually distinctive characters.
